Solano County, located northeast of San Francisco and southwest of Sacramento, is bordered in the south by the San Pablo Bay, Carquinez Strait, Suisun Bay, Grizzly Bay, and the Sacramento River, giving residents and visitors plenty of water access for boating, sailing, fishing and more.

Boasting its own parks and attractions such as Six Flags Discovery Kingdom, Mare Island Historic Park, the Western Railway Museum, Naval & History Museum, Benicia State Recreation Area, Sandy Beach Campground and Park, golf courses and Vacaville Premium Outlets shopping center, Solano County also borders the world-renowned Napa Valley wine region and is a quick day-trip away from Lake Tahoe, San Francisco, Redwood forests and the Pacific Coast.

One of the more affordable housing markets throughout the Bay Area, Solano County is becoming a popular destination for those wishing to settle in to this region. Commuters can easily catch the Capitol Corridor train, which runs between San Jose and Colfax, with convenient stops along the route throughout the county.

Fairfield is the county seat and the home to Travis Air Force Base, contributing to its ranking as the second largest town in the county by population. Some additional cities and towns in Solano County include Vallejo (largest by population), Vacaville, Suisun City, Benicia, Dixon, Rio Vista and Allendale. Other small towns in the county host farms, vineyards and ranches, including a large wind farm near Birds Landing for renewable energy generation.
